Young puppies must be immunized
If you have a pup, it is important that they are up-to-date on all their vaccinations. This will help them communicate securely with various other pet dogs and individuals. A vet can establish the best vaccine timetable for young puppies. Vaccinations are usually given in 2 to four-week intervals up until your young puppy is 16 weeks old. Along with a detailed test, your pup will certainly obtain several shots.

Core puppy shots/vaccinations consist of DAPPv, which protects against canine distemper, adenovirus (liver disease), parvovirus, and parainfluenza; and the rabies vaccination, which prevents the possibly deadly rabies infection. The rabies vaccination is legitimately called for in several states. On top of that, non-core pup vaccinations can consist of the lyme condition injection, leptospirosis injection, and Bordetella, which stops kennel cough. The latter is recommended for puppies and dogs that visit pet parks, groomers, traveling, or be boarded. It is additionally practical to go to a veterinary-approved young puppy socialization class during this moment. This will certainly enable your young puppy to play with other immunized pets and humans in controlled environments.

Puppies need to be mingled
Pup day care offers a structured setting for your pet to shed energy and socialize. It additionally offers young puppies the possibility to learn just how to engage safely with people and various other pet dogs, which is important for their development. Pup childcare can likewise help with basic training, such as potty training and chain strolling.

During puppy socializing classes, your pup will certainly be subjected to other pups of different breeds, ages, and dimensions as well as individuals and kids. They will be permitted to engage with them briefly yet except extended amount of times. Young puppy classes might likewise expose your pup to new objects, such as skateboards, wheelchairs, going shopping carts, bicycles, and crates; and seems like vacuum cleaners, songs, and noises from the kitchen or vet offices.

Nonetheless, it is essential to remember that pups are not implied to run into many people and locations at one time. This can be frustrating and cause them to create afraid responses as adults.
